Transaction edc6dcd178ceb72c46e6c23afaa19be7d52f87de1aa4ca84165303b7a49b8105
1 Input
1 Output
-
edc6dcd178ceb72c46e6c23afaa19be7d52f87de1aa4ca84165303b7a49b8105:0
- value
- 728697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b43f33ae32a29fbf41b4b905541d752a08dc5abe OP_EQUAL
- address
- 3J85GR7kB62CNNcenDRJibBxLudoQNAsFi